MongoDB Change Streams: Real-Time Data for Developers | iCert Global

Blog Banner Image

In modern software development, the demand for real-time data processing is at an all-time high. Developers must instantly react to changes in their database. They need to trigger actions based on new information. And, their apps must be up-to-date with the latest data. This is where MongoDB Change Streams come in. They give developers a tool for real-time data sync, monitoring, and event-driven apps.

What are MongoDB Change Streams?

MongoDB Change Streams let developers get real-time updates from their database. MongoDB Change Streams capture any change to a document in the database. This includes inserts, updates, or deletes. They then push that change to a specified application in real time. This lets developers respond to changes as they happen. They can then build apps that are always in sync with the database.

MongoDB Change Streams allow developers to listen to changes in collections or databases in real-time. This enables them to build event-driven applications. Change Streams let applications react instantly to database changes. They can respond to inserts, updates, or deletions without polling. This feature is useful for real-time analytics, notifications, and syncing data across systems.

How do MongoDB Change Streams work?

MongoDB Change Streams create an update stream on a specified collection in the database. Then, this update stream can be pipelined through an aggregation pipeline. It lets developers transform the data before sending it to the application. It lets developers customize the data stream for their app. They can filter out certain data, aggregate values, or enrich it with extra info.

MongoDB Change Streams allow developers to listen for real-time changes in collections. This enables event-driven architectures and live applications. They capture changes like inserts, updates, and deletes. They provide a continuous, ordered stream of events. This feature is ideal for live data sync, notifications, or real-time analytics without polling the database.

What are the benefits of using MongoDB Change Streams?

MongoDB Change Streams give real-time updates on database changes. They let developers build responsive, event-driven apps. This feature syncs data across microservices or external systems. It improves workflows that need up-to-the-minute data. Also, Change Streams support scalability. They process data changes with low resource use. So, they are ideal for large-scale apps.

  • Real-time processing: MongoDB Change Streams let developers react to database changes instantly. This helps them build apps that are always up-to-date.

  • Scalable architecture: MongoDB Change Streams let developers easily scale their real-time data as their app grows.

  • Push notifications: Developers can use MongoDB Change Streams to trigger actions, such as sending push notifications to users, based on changes in the database.

  • Data-driven decision-making: Using MongoDB Change Streams, developers can build apps that use the latest, most accurate data.

  • MongoDB Change Streams offer an efficient way to sync data. They can sync data between different parts of an app or between services.

How can developers implement MongoDB Change Streams in their application?

To use MongoDB Change Streams, developers must first set up a change event listener on a collection in their database. This listener will receive change events as they occur, allowing developers to react to them in real time. Developers can use these change events to trigger functions, update the UI, send notifications, or take other actions based on the new data.

Developers can use MongoDB Change Streams by connecting to a MongoDB collection. They can then use the `watch()` method to track real-time changes in the database. Change Streams let apps listen for insertions, updates, and deletions. They are perfect for real-time analytics, notifications, and event-driven architectures. By integrating these streams, developers can instantly respond to data changes. They won't need to poll the database.

How to obtain Mongo DB Developer certification? 

We are an Education Technology company providing certification training courses to accelerate careers of working professionals worldwide. We impart training through instructor-led classroom workshops, instructor-led live virtual training sessions, and self-paced e-learning courses.

We have successfully conducted training sessions in 108 countries across the globe and enabled thousands of working professionals to enhance the scope of their careers.

Our enterprise training portfolio includes in-demand and globally recognized certification training courses in Project Management, Quality Management, Business Analysis, IT Service Management, Agile and Scrum, Cyber Security, Data Science, and Emerging Technologies. Download our Enterprise Training Catalog from https://www.icertglobal.com/corporate-training-for-enterprises.php and https://www.icertglobal.com/index.php

Popular Courses include:

  • Project Management: PMP, CAPM ,PMI RMP

  • Quality Management: Six Sigma Black Belt ,Lean Six Sigma Green Belt, Lean Management, Minitab,CMMI

  • Business Analysis: CBAP, CCBA, ECBA

  • Agile Training: PMI-ACP , CSM , CSPO

  • Scrum Training: CSM

  • DevOps

  • Program Management: PgMP

  • Cloud Technology: Exin Cloud Computing

  • Citrix Client Adminisration: Citrix Cloud Administration

The 10 top-paying certifications to target in 2024 are:

Conclusion

In conclusion, MongoDB Change Streams are a powerful tool. They help developers build real-time, data-driven apps. Using MongoDB Change Streams, developers can create always-up-to-date, responsive apps. They can handle many use cases. MongoDB Change Streams can help you. Use them for a dashboard, a decision tool, or a real-time analytics platform.

Contact Us For More Information:

Visit www.icertglobal.com     Email : info@icertglobal.com

       Description: iCertGlobal Instagram Description: iCertGlobal YoutubeDescription: iCertGlobal linkedinDescription: iCertGlobal facebook iconDescription: iCertGlobal twitterDescription: iCertGlobal twitter



Comments (0)


Write a Comment

Your email address will not be published. Required fields are marked (*)



Subscribe to our YouTube channel
Follow us on Instagram
top-10-highest-paying-certifications-to-target-in-2020





Disclaimer

  • "PMI®", "PMBOK®", "PMP®", "CAPM®" and "PMI-ACP®" are registered marks of the Project Management Institute, Inc.
  • "CSM", "CST" are Registered Trade Marks of The Scrum Alliance, USA.
  • COBIT® is a trademark of ISACA® registered in the United States and other countries.
  • CBAP® and IIBA® are registered trademarks of International Institute of Business Analysis™.

We Accept

We Accept

Follow Us

iCertGlobal facebook icon
iCertGlobal twitter
iCertGlobal linkedin

iCertGlobal Instagram
iCertGlobal twitter
iCertGlobal Youtube

Quick Enquiry Form

WhatsApp Us  /      +1 (713)-287-1187